GEOINT and Cyber Security

For this discussion of GEOINT in relation to cyber operations, I found a notable resource that discusses the intersection of these fields, particularly how the Department of Defense and the intelligence community leverage GIS&T alongside geospatial intelligence for cyber analysis. The content discusses the evolution of information technology infrastructure and its implications for GEOINT, especially in light of recent history in regions such as Northern Africa and the Middle East. The integration of geolocating technologies with communications infrastructures has notably changed dynamics in these areas, hinting at the pivotal role GEOINT plays in understanding and responding to cyberspace activities?? (GEOG 882: Geographic Foundations of Geospatial Intelligence, 2023).

Another interesting case is the application of GIS by German cybersecurity experts to visualize and understand patterns of hacker attacks. This approach was notably used to foresee Russia's actions during the annexation of Crimea by analyzing the construction of undersea cables, indicating a strategic move to control communications. The use of GIS allowed the team to understand the geographical context of cyber operations, emphasizing the importance of spatial analysis in cybersecurity?? (GIS: Cybersecurity: The Geospatial Edge, 2023).

What intrigues me about the relationship between geospatial intelligence and cyberspace operations is the capacity of GEOINT to add a tangible, geographical dimension to the typically abstract concept of cyber threats. The ability to visualize and analyze cyber activities in a spatial context enhances understanding and response strategies, making GEOINT an invaluable tool in the modern cyber and intelligence arsenal.

However, concerns do arise from the inherent challenges in securing geospatial data and infrastructure against cyber threats. The manipulation of geospatial data, cyber espionage, and attacks on critical infrastructure highlight the vulnerability of GEOINT systems to cyber operations. The integration of these domains means that cybersecurity measures and continuous adaptation are needed to protect against evolving threats????.
